Ken has had a diverse and fulfilling career as a Landscape Architect, spanning over 40 years. He has worked for prestigious organizations such as the DOI National Park Service, the US Army Corps of Engineers, and the USDA Natural Resources Conservation Service. In 1973, while studying Landscape Architecture at Iowa State University, Ken began to learn to play the violin by ear. His musical journey continued many years later when he took formal violin lessons from Ken Pitts, the former orchestra director in Fort Worth, Texas and a founding member of the Light Crust Dough Boys. Ken is a versatile creator and performer who relishes the process of composing and playing his original tunes on violin. He also enjoys improvising and playing complementary parts across a variety of genres, including folk, bluegrass, country, Celtic, and light rock, often collaborating with friends. Every Wednesday, Ken and guitarist Ron Parker can be found at the Iron Wolf Coffee House in Davis, Oklahoma, where they perform their original tunes and a few cover songs. Their collaboration on original music has been ongoing since 2003. For the past 15 years, Ken has also been an organizer and weekly performer at the large Centennario Restaurant in Sulphur, Oklahoma. The group, which typically consists of 3-7 musicians, features a mix of instruments such as guitar, mandolin, 5-string banjo, double bass, harmonica, and fiddle along with vocals. Ken treasures his 1830s Charotte-Milott violin, made in Mirecourt, France. He acquired this cherished instrument from a retired farmer who inherited it from his aunt, a violinist in the Omaha Orchestra and an avid collector of antique violins. In 2024, Ken invented an adjustable magnetic system designed to hold a violin or viola securely on the shoulder. He filed a USPO Provisional Patent for this innovative device. Encouraged by fellow violinists, Ken founded VHold LLC in 2025 to produce and market the Violin Pro-Hold product.
